Serie A: Inter Milan 2-0 Juventus

Sunday, April 18, 2010

Inter Milan moved back to the top of Serie A thanks to a 2-0 win over stubborn 10-man Juventus at the San Siro.

Juventus were left with an uphill struggle after 37 minutes when Mohamed Sissoko was sent off for two bookings but they managed to keep the defending champions at bay until 15 minutes from time, when Maicon juggled the ball on the edge of the penalty area before volleying it past Gianluigi Buffon.

Samuel Eto'o then sealed the win in stoppage-time when he placed the ball into an empty net after reaching a low cross from Sulley Muntari.
